Weather & Climate in Owensville, OH

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.

Owensville experiences four distinct seasons with an average annual temperature of 54°F (12°C). Winters average 30°F in January while summers reach 75°F in July. The area gets 297 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 43. The city sits at an elevation of 865 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 30°F (-1°C) 2.8 in Coldest
February 32°F (0°C) 2.8 in Driest
March 42°F (6°C) 4.1 in
April 52°F (11°C) 4.1 in
May 62°F (17°C) 4.7 in Wettest
June 70°F (21°C) 3.8 in
July 75°F (24°C) 4.4 in Warmest
August 73°F (23°C) 3.9 in
September 66°F (19°C) 3.4 in
October 55°F (13°C) 2.8 in
November 44°F (7°C) 3.5 in
December 34°F (1°C) 3.2 in

Owensville has a seasonal temperature swing of 45°F / from 30°F in January to 75°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 43.4 inches, with May being the wettest month (4.7") and February the driest (2.8").
